So I seem to be having the same problem with a Lenovo X1 (1286-CTO) laptop. I do not have a bluetooth, unknown or any devices in device manager with a ! next to them. When I click fn + f5 I do not get an option to turn on/off bluetooth, but I do have a wireless option, which is on. I have checked BIOS multiple times and bluetooth is enabled under security. I have a bluetooth light next to the wireless radio light that shows green on Post but then turns off and never turns back on once Windows 7 starts loading. I've tried uninstall/re-install latest versions of all lenovo drivers/software including Hotkeys and Power Manager. I've re-installed windows and updated everything and still can not even get bluetooth to show up in the device manger or anywhere else. When I try to install the Bluetooth drivers from lenovo or broadcomm widcomm I get an error that Bluetooth device not detected. I'm at a loss of what to try next.
